Phil Gaimon Crash

On Friday, former Professional road cyclist Phil Gaimon was racing at the Velodrome in Trexlertown, PA when he suffered a bad crash that resulted in a broken his scapula, collarbone, five ribs, and a partially collapsed lung.  Gaimon recently announced his quest to make the Olympic Team for the 2020 Olympics in the Team Pursuit and was …

Tour of Utah

Organizers of the 2019 Larry H. Miller Tour of Utah announced the details for the 477-mile (767.8-kilometer) race route, taking place across northern Utah on Aug. 12-18. Thirteen Utah Office of Tourism King of the Mountain climbs will be contested across the grandeur and grind of alpine terrain, including 37,882 feet (11,546 meters) of elevation …
